Subject: Cut-over complete — token refresh fix live

Plugin authors,

The Keyward session-token refresh bug is fixed and the cut-over finished last night. Tokens no longer expire mid-refresh when clock skew exceeds 30 seconds; the grace window now applies server-side. Old refresh endpoints return 410 as of today. Update your plugins against the v4 SDK — v3 calls will fail after the deprecation window. No action needed beyond rebuilding against the values below.

settings of fafog-haduf:
ZORIX_PIN=4648
ZORIX_METRICS_HOST=metrics.zorix.paliqsys.corp
ZORIX_LOG_LEVEL=info
ZORIX_TENANT=druix

Finance Review Summary — Billing Model Change

As of next quarter, Vantrel Systems will move all Ledgerline subscriptions from monthly to annual billing. Expected effects: improved cash predictability, modest churn risk in the small-tier segment, and a one-time deferred revenue adjustment. Collections workflows will be updated by the Harwick office. Context on the strategic reasoning appears in the confidential note below.

confidential, yahip-hagug: Gorixax Logistics plans to lower the Ulaael list price by 26.6 percent in October. The pricing group signed off on a budget of $199.9 million for Project Holix. The renewal with Kasdorox Systems closes at $137.5 million a year, 8.2 percent above the last contract. Project Lamion slips by a full year because of the audit delay.

Runbook: session-token refresh failures (plugin authors)

Symptom: tokens issued by the Larkspur session broker occasionally fail refresh with a spurious "stale nonce" error when the refresh lands within 2 seconds of expiry. Mitigation: refresh at 80% of token lifetime, never at expiry, and treat the stale-nonce error as retryable exactly once after a 3-second pause. Do not mint a fresh session on first failure — that orphans the old one and exhausts quota. Refresh calls authenticate with the broker's internal key, shown directly below.

app token of kagap-fahag = zpat2_0m